Question Without Notice No. 1216 asked in the Legislative Council on 23 November 2022 by Hon Nick Goiran

Parliament: 41 Session: 1

GUARDIANSHIP AND ADMINISTRATION ACT — STATUTORY REVIEW

1216. Hon NICK GOIRAN to the parliamentary secretary representing the Attorney General:

I refer to the answers to my questions without notice 520 and 605 last year regarding the review of part 9E of the Guardianship and Administration Act 1990.

(1) Does the Attorney General recall informing the house that a report on this review is to be tabled by no later than 7 April 2022?

(2) Will the Attorney General table the most recent briefing note or similar document he has received regarding this review and its report?

(3) If no to (2), why not?

Hon MATTHEW SWINBOURN replied:

I thank the member for some notice of the question. The following answer is based on information provided to me by the Attorney General.

(1)–(3) In 2021, in accordance with the governance requirements of its evaluation and review steering committee, the Department of Justice established a project reference group to facilitate and guide the review of the amendment act and prepare the report on the review. The PRG prepared a discussion paper for distribution to stakeholders and consulted widely during the review. Stakeholder views were collated and analysed to inform the PRG's findings and recommendations in relation to the amendment act, which will be included in the final report. I table a copy of this discussion paper, and note that the final report will be tabled as soon as practicable.

[See paper 1881.]
